Your Role on the Team
Job duties include, but are not limited to:
- Review and resolve billing edit errors prior to claim submission to ensure clean, accurate claims and timely reimbursement.
- Collect on insurance accounts by working assigned accounts receivable worklists, aging reports, and correspondence.
- Analyze patient accounts to determine appropriate billing or collection actions in compliance with payer guidelines.
- Communicate with payors and internal stakeholders to resolve billing and collection issues efficiently.
What It Takes to be Successful
Required:
- Experience with professional fee medical billing, including Medicare, Medi-Cal, Workers’ Compensation, and commercial insurance plans.
- Strong customer service skills with the ability to communicate clearly and professionally in English.
- Ability to analyze accounts, manage workload effectively, and meet monthly productivity standards.
- Demonstrated ability to collaborate and maintain effective working relationships across a healthcare system.
- Ability to read, write, and follow written and oral instructions in English.
Preferred:
- Experience with patient registration and authorization processes.
- Proficiency using payor websites for claim status review and collections follow-up.
- Experience with Epic Billing or similar medical billing systems.
- Background in professional fee medical collections within a healthcare or academic medical setting.
